SPECTROPHOTOMETRIC MEASURING METHOD, SPECTROPHOTOMETER, CELL FOR SPECTROPHOTOMETRY, AND METHOD OF FILLING CELL WITH SPECIMEN

机译:分光光度法,分光光度计,分光光度法的细胞以及用标本填充细胞的方法

摘要

PROBLEM TO BE SOLVED: To provide the cell of a spectrophotometer which ensures a sufficient light path length even with respect to a very small amount of a specimen and precisely measures the absorbance of the specimen, and to provide the spectrophotometer.;SOLUTION: A measuring cell 52 is constituted of a fine pipe part 53 for a light waveguide comprising quartz glass and a specimen filling fine pipe part 54 and, when the measuring cell 52 is filled with the specimen 100, the fine pipe part 53 for the light waveguide functions as the light waveguide. The spectrophotometer 4 has a light injection means 60 and a light receiving means 65 and inspection light is thrown on one opening end 53a of the fine pipe part 53 for the light waveguide by the light injection means 60. The incident light is transmitted through the specimen while subjected to the total reflection in the fine pipe part 53 for the light waveguide and emitted from the other opening end 53b. The emitted transmitted light is received by the light receiving means 65 to calculate absorbance. Since a sufficient light path length is ensured in the axial direction of the fine pipe part 53 for the light waveguide, the amount of the specimen charged in the fine pipe is very little, the absorbance of the specimen is precisely measured.;COPYRIGHT: (C)2009,JPO&INPIT
